FRIED CHICKEN DRUMSTICKS SOUTHERN STYLE

Time 1h5m

Yield 3-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 chicken legs
2 eggs (beaten)
4 cups vegetable oil
1 cup flour
1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 teaspoon paprika
1 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Before frying, boil chicken legs in a pot of water for 10 minutes.
  • In a large saucepan, heat vegetable oil on medium heat.
  • On a large plate, combine flour, cayenne pepper, paprika, and salt.
  • Keep beaten eggs in a separate bowl.
  • Take 1 chicken leg and cover it is flour mixture.
  • Place the chicken leg in eggs and cover it in egg.
  • Place the chicken leg back into the flour mixture and cover it again in flour.
  • Once oil is hot and ready for frying, place chicken leg into the oil for frying.
  • Repeat steps 5-8 for each chicken leg allowing up to 3 legs to fry at one time.
  • Once legs are fried to a golden brown, remove from oil and place on a double-folded paper towel on a plate.
  • Allow plenty of time to cool before serving.
